The Wietenberg culture was a Middle Bronze Age archeological culture in central Romania (Transylvania) that roughly dates to 2200-1600/1500 BCE.Represented a local variant of Usatove culture, was contemporary with the Ottomny culture and Unetice culture and was replaced by the Noua culture.Its name was coined after the eponymic Wietenberg Hill near Sighioara. Wittenberg Mountain, locally "the Wittenberg," is a mountain located in Ulster County, New York.The mountain is part of the Burroughs Range of the Catskill Mountains.Wittenberg is flanked to the southwest by Cornell Mountain and to the northeast by Terrace Mountain.. Wittenberg Mountain stands within the watershed of Esopus Creek, which drains into the Hudson River, and into New York Bay. Luther sparked the Reformation in 1517 by posting, at least according to tradition, his "95 Theses" on the door of the Castle Church in Wittenberg, Germany - these theses were a list of statements that expressed Luther's concerns about certain Church practices - largely the sale of indulgences, but they .
